To You

Our love is laughter
Silver bells tinkling on door frames
Sparkling lights on cold winter evenings

Our love is dancing
Country music playing through living room speakers
Beer cans and wine glasses on the table

Our love is sadness
Memories of past loss and current stressors
Bedroom snuggles with whispers and kisses

Our love is compassion
Undying support
Motivation to do more...to be more

Our love is unwavering 
For if I fall I know you will catch me
I will hold you when you are weak

Our love is more
No words accurately enough describe us
Capturing our love is like bottling air
Too big to be contained
Never ending and everywhere
